SETON (MODERN) SOLID it has always been knownThe Setons had early links with the House of Gordon. From the Sobieski's 'Vestiarium Scoticum' (1842). This is remarkably close to Morrison which the Sobieskis may well have seen and altered very slightly to make this Seton.
